Danielle Brown
Double Paralympic archery gold medallist Danielle Brown has proven that disability is no barrier to achieving whatever you wish. The first athlete to also represent England in an able-bodied discipline, Danielle’s drive and determination to succeed is exemplary. A wonderful Olympic speaker, Danielle enjoys all challenges in life and delivers invaluable advice to both business and social environments to ensure listeners achieve all they can.

Danielle’s versatility and experience make her one of the most desirable personalities on the after dinner speaker circuit. Ranked World No.1 for her entire career, Danielle has faultlessly performed year on year. A three time World Champion, Danielle has also won gold at the Delhi Commonwealth Games of 2010 in an able bodied discipline, showing her skill and focus is enough to beat even the best able-bodied athletes.

Dee Sign BSL (British Sign Language) Choir
Dee Sign Choir is one of the original signing choirs in the UK.
Established in 1997 and based in Chester, they have spent the past 26 years enthralling audiences with a broad repertoire of pop songs, favourites from the musicals, Christmas songs and carols.

The choir perform to raise Deaf Awareness and raise funds for Chester & District Committee for Deaf People. We’re delighted to have Dee Sign BSL Choir performing at No Limits this year.

Dogs for Good
Dogs for Good train dogs to help people affected by disability, dementia, autism and other mental-health challenges to live happier, healthier, more independent lives. These are dogs that open doors, that connect people, that bring families together. Dogs that help make everyday life possible in so many ways.

Dogs for Good service user Linda will be attending No Limits to talk about her life with assistance dog Poppy.

Georgina Durrant
Georgina Durrant is an author, former teacher, Special Educational Needs Coordinator and the founder of the award-winning SEN Resources Blog, where she shares activities, advice and recommendations for parents and teachers of children with SEND. She hosts the podcast ‘SEND in the Experts with Georgina Durrant’ and is the author of three Special Educational Needs
and Disability books: 100 Ways Your Child Can Learn Through Play, How to Boost Reading and Writing Through Play (JKP) and her latest book SEND Strategies for the Primary Years, which is out in June.

Georgina’s parenting and education advice regularly features in the press and media including The Independent, Guardian and Telegraph and most recently on Sky News.

Pete Selwood
Pete is becoming a very familiar face on the UK comedy circuit. Performing for clubs such as Glee, Last Laugh, Alexanders & Laughterhouse. Pete is now headlining for the likes of Avalon and Off The Kerb.

Alongside that Pete is regularly providing tour support for Jack Carroll and has also starred in a BBC3 Sketch alongside Jack entitled ‘Disable In Da Club’. To top that off Pete has appeared in two seasons of The Emily Atack Show on ITV2, The Likely Dads on BBC Radio 4, and a small role in Shane Meadows’ Gallows Pole.

After a rip-roaring performance at No Limits in 2022, we’re delighted to confirm Pete will be returning to the No Limits stage this year.
